Definitions from Wiktionary (Dayton)
▸ noun: (countable) A surname.
▸ noun: (uncountable) A placename, from the surname:
▸ noun: A suburb of Perth, Western Australia, Australia; named for Walter Warner Day, a cattle and wine pioneer in the area.
▸ noun: A community of Nova Scotia, Canada.
▸ noun: A number of places in the United States
▸ noun: A town in Alabama.
▸ noun: A city in Idaho.
▸ noun: A town in Indiana.
▸ noun: A city in Iowa; named for the city in Ohio.
▸ noun: A city in Kentucky; named for the city in Ohio.
▸ noun: A town in Maine; named for Thomas Day, who submitted the petition for the area to become a town.
▸ noun: A city in Minnesota; named for founder Lyman Dayton.
▸ noun: A census-designated place in Montana.
▸ noun: A census-designated place in New Jersey; named for Jonathan Dayton.
▸ noun: A town in New York.
▸ noun: A census-designated place in Lyon County, Nevada, United States; named for John Day, a local surveyor.
▸ noun: A city, the county seat of Montgomery County, Ohio; named for Jonathan Dayton, a Constitution signatory and statesman.
▸ noun: A city in Oregon.
▸ noun: A borough of Pennsylvania.
▸ noun: A city, the county seat of Rhea County, Tennessee; named for the city in Ohio.
▸ noun: A city in Texas.
▸ noun: A town in Virginia.
▸ noun: A city, the county seat of Columbia County, Washington; named for Jesse Day.
▸ noun: A place in Wisconsin
▸ noun: A town in Richland County, Wisconsin.
▸ noun: A town in Waupaca County, Wisconsin; named for early settler Lyman Dayton.
▸ noun: A town in Wyoming; named for founder Joe Dayton Thorne.
